Warcraft 3 1.17 Patch Out

10

Blizzard let us know that the latest patch for Warcraft 3 is now available through the game's auto-updater. You can read about the many changes and additions (two new neutral Heroes) right here.

Filed Under
From The Chatty
Hello, Meet Lola